1970s Trompe-l’œil Side Table – Painted Metal – in the manner of Jacques Adnet / Hermès

A distinctive and decorative vintage side table from the 1970s, made of painted metal in trompe-l’œil style, with the metal skillfully shaped and finished to imitate leather straps with buckles.

The design is clearly inspired by the iconic leather furniture of Jacques Adnet, known for his work with Hermès. However, this is an interpretation from the 1970s and not a design by Adnet himself, nor a Hermès product.

The side table features an elegant tripod construction with curved 'strap' legs and a thick round glass top. The combination of illusionistic finish and equestrian design makes it a true showpiece and a beloved collectible within mid-century and eclectic interiors.
